Output ed75cc8a1266b5e9d93247742fb7c4b20f23812deaf1ce90a2e18850f692c444:126

value
259563
script pubkey
OP_0 OP_PUSHBYTES_20 a2bb8b9b80a66194fe22a00b4040b0c14c4176f8
address
bc1q52achxuq5esefl3z5q95qs9sc9xyzahcje0vwq
transaction
ed75cc8a1266b5e9d93247742fb7c4b20f23812deaf1ce90a2e18850f692c444